Canterbury pick up first points of State Championship

Canterbury picked up their first points of the State Championship first class cricket competition, holding on for a draw against leaders Central Districts in Rangiora.

With a lead of 188 and over an hour's play left, Central skipper Mathew Sinclair declined to offer a draw and asked Canterbury to bat again on a day that had seen number of stoppages due to rain.

Central bowler Mitchell McClenaghan took a hat-trick before the game was eventually called off with Canterbury 19 for 3.

Canterbury took points for winning the first innings but despite going home without any points, Central retained their lead at the top of the standings on 25.

Auckland, who beat Northern Districts by 22 runs moved into second spot on 19, one ahead of Wellington, who drew with Otago but lost on first innings.

In the next round starting on Friday Central host Wellington, Canterbury host Northern and Otago host Auckland.
